*** INSTRUCTIONS TO THE TEMPLATE USER:

*** This template follows the Symbian Foundation coding conventions.
*** Remove all unneeded declarations and definitions before checking 
*** the file in!  Also remove the template's usage instructions, that is, 
*** everything that begins with "***".

*** The copyright years should be < the year of the file's creation >
*** - < the year of the file's latest update >.

*** Words that begin with "?" are for you to replace with your own
*** identifiers, filenames, or comments.

*** To support building on Linux, use only forward slashes in include
*** directives.  Also, all filenames and pathnames must be completely
*** in lowercase.

*** Indent four spaces per step, using spaces, not tabs, to display
*** the code consistently across different editors.
